Mech-Eye Industrial 3D Camera API
Project description
Mech-Eye Python Interface
This is the official Python interface for Mech-Eye cameras.
Please select the proper version corresponding to the camera firmware version.
Features
With these interfaces, you can easily control your Mech-Eye cameras with Python programs. The features are as follows:
- Connect to your camera in your LAN.
- Set and get camera parameters such as exposure time, ROI, and so on.
- Capture color images, depth maps, and point clouds.
Installation
Dependencies
We ran and tested these interfaces on Python3.7 - Python3.11.
The numpy library is needed:
you can install numpy with pip using the following command:
pip install numpy
Installing official version from PyPI using PIP
Use PIP to fetch the latest official version from PyPI:
pip install MechEyeAPI
On some systems Python3's pip is called pip3. In this guide we assume it is called pip. If you are using PIP with version 19 or higher, build dependencies are handled automatically.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distributions
Built Distributions
Filter files by name, interpreter, ABI, and platform.
If you're not sure about the file name format, learn more about wheel file names.
Copy a direct link to the current filters
File details
Details for the file mecheyeapi-2.5.4-cp311-cp311-win_amd64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p311-cp311-win_amd64.whl
- Upload date:
- Size: 15.8 MB
- Tags: CPython 3.11, Windows x86-64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
deb181d90a9fb7b63fd8534a63912a49f34d24af0560fd6f109fa7e10750cfd6
|
|
| MD5 |
2c7d554dc16440a4c7b1e81a253d845f
|
|
| BLAKE2b-256 |
8fdac3eb51a2cd804e50e0e05697af995b1d83f190ec13a246641beb3e37ade8
|
File details
Details for the file mecheyeapi-2.5.4-cp311-cp311-manylinux_2_27_x86_64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p311-cp311-manylinux_2_27_x86_64.whl
- Upload date:
- Size: 22.7 MB
- Tags: CPython 3.11, manylinux: glibc 2.27+ x86-64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
9fe2c2e30797fc4e5f54e7aea8fe5f8d828cb084af3c0b0373ce292e553ec38f
|
|
| MD5 |
31d51e7a68606a2c1d2c19c7a66d986d
|
|
| BLAKE2b-256 |
d5244ff54ad5cb598462c448ae7697675d48c73f3689835143d5d0aac5c50bd7
|
File details
Details for the file mecheyeapi-2.5.4-cp311-cp311-manylinux_2_27_aarch64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p311-cp311-manylinux_2_27_aarch64.whl
- Upload date:
- Size: 10.6 MB
- Tags: CPython 3.11, manylinux: glibc 2.27+ ARM64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
7ba99b7aef863b3fc2557fc66d045fad475c162562d7cac39bb8dcf930382516
|
|
| MD5 |
f4362f674f36b14d734295393a26d688
|
|
| BLAKE2b-256 |
f37be923d9d23f0517ed1c8e3ef6c0aa564d00fbc87ed7e3ebb89442c7d45d84
|
File details
Details for the file mecheyeapi-2.5.4-cp310-cp310-win_amd64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p310-cp310-win_amd64.whl
- Upload date:
- Size: 15.8 MB
- Tags: CPython 3.10, Windows x86-64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
a3fad5949fd086794bfdd052b1f0d344812b6066e379596b2413bbf9722f5d88
|
|
| MD5 |
42a79e6a95bbe70d0dc1ab213a891375
|
|
| BLAKE2b-256 |
bc3fdd0eede283d873346e90cf351c69a1fd724f344f7f10c69bfcd6cc356913
|
File details
Details for the file mecheyeapi-2.5.4-cp310-cp310-manylinux_2_27_x86_64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p310-cp310-manylinux_2_27_x86_64.whl
- Upload date:
- Size: 22.7 MB
- Tags: CPython 3.10, manylinux: glibc 2.27+ x86-64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
e016f15590f31ade3f3195a2a4e10fb9d1a8ef00e6e8f96d6082b3f6ac8f1d64
|
|
| MD5 |
b988c370c07613372c690926766e65d2
|
|
| BLAKE2b-256 |
bcdeff9743861b8c6115b2e90c57b14efff91763def93961d5e46a5341e3a251
|
File details
Details for the file mecheyeapi-2.5.4-cp310-cp310-manylinux_2_27_aarch64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p310-cp310-manylinux_2_27_aarch64.whl
- Upload date:
- Size: 10.6 MB
- Tags: CPython 3.10, manylinux: glibc 2.27+ ARM64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
d6d055688280353816a8d485bc8d2f054db0a34d0bcb777d8545214bbb981237
|
|
| MD5 |
a7f8bd79dfe36b9718146ec4c43a6045
|
|
| BLAKE2b-256 |
312f4463565cf7db9022959160b0b899fd4877d16180877e8ebb0559aad2240a
|
File details
Details for the file mecheyeapi-2.5.4-cp39-cp39-win_amd64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p39-cp39-win_amd64.whl
- Upload date:
- Size: 15.8 MB
- Tags: CPython 3.9, Windows x86-64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
a9ab6e9234d8b4454a33bfe0707496b0600cb45b13651df5a7c4ce438977a11a
|
|
| MD5 |
44480f33e8d8027e87de575c6c14d054
|
|
| BLAKE2b-256 |
fc9117527c42285dcb88943862edc961d4c1d9b65e3a1138ec0bf608fd9c3be5
|
File details
Details for the file mecheyeapi-2.5.4-cp39-cp39-manylinux_2_27_x86_64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p39-cp39-manylinux_2_27_x86_64.whl
- Upload date:
- Size: 22.7 MB
- Tags: CPython 3.9, manylinux: glibc 2.27+ x86-64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
46154d539e6a40ec9515e7fdc0c55e78d31d08e9c7785cc8f07f0ec2e9f541ab
|
|
| MD5 |
b0fb4b77262fe33e3fa97c113375a2a7
|
|
| BLAKE2b-256 |
9ab847470d547e85194d6da54941e0486cc493efa441c5a5bcc6fa239daade39
|
File details
Details for the file mecheyeapi-2.5.4-cp39-cp39-manylinux_2_27_aarch64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p39-cp39-manylinux_2_27_aarch64.whl
- Upload date:
- Size: 10.6 MB
- Tags: CPython 3.9, manylinux: glibc 2.27+ ARM64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
a4e2b3d70e2da2c534722de1158d31e01cbd63d5f2b413dae2372a0b47e89a44
|
|
| MD5 |
382644229acc1958e8f641242329cb20
|
|
| BLAKE2b-256 |
dbf07d2f8facddac2546b2fb61a6806f9f72ef4ec6260f062ac82b55e745af20
|
File details
Details for the file mecheyeapi-2.5.4-cp38-cp38-win_amd64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p38-cp38-win_amd64.whl
- Upload date:
- Size: 15.8 MB
- Tags: CPython 3.8, Windows x86-64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
e3804594243449505d08846248c49b669c11ee9e1faa7281a8ff28aabb429d50
|
|
| MD5 |
b95fe304eabc9f05fb0170a473e30659
|
|
| BLAKE2b-256 |
aad05e7c6ae55116481f8fba4216f13fda927f30742461988bee11d77ef17d81
|
File details
Details for the file mecheyeapi-2.5.4-cp38-cp38-manylinux_2_27_x86_64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p38-cp38-manylinux_2_27_x86_64.whl
- Upload date:
- Size: 22.7 MB
- Tags: CPython 3.8, manylinux: glibc 2.27+ x86-64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
b20647d95d411e51018afe239745f0c16c19a05287f75085ac4207ca889a29db
|
|
| MD5 |
c0dc96133819afa23ae10578f3eb2a5a
|
|
| BLAKE2b-256 |
ddfc2dc4677070517987ab1e4b4775a993342288a8d8582dec62fa1222214d2d
|
File details
Details for the file mecheyeapi-2.5.4-cp38-cp38-manylinux_2_27_aarch64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p38-cp38-manylinux_2_27_aarch64.whl
- Upload date:
- Size: 10.6 MB
- Tags: CPython 3.8, manylinux: glibc 2.27+ ARM64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
7229b2e581af54380328845c5c828c9b47e0e0982d5a40dba39be6dda86adc45
|
|
| MD5 |
dac782aad0664584a7a86de151e5d8c0
|
|
| BLAKE2b-256 |
d8ea39494964953e3e2a340c2d462474bc87c68099dda42b6ef51f805efa1465
|
File details
Details for the file mecheyeapi-2.5.4-cp37-cp37m-win_amd64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p37-cp37m-win_amd64.whl
- Upload date:
- Size: 15.8 MB
- Tags: CPython 3.7m, Windows x86-64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
3156c25138f03f07eb79f0d036c3e613cdfa5faca94349091a3b03bc16f4456b
|
|
| MD5 |
25a3003c511b661042ef5c293d836714
|
|
| BLAKE2b-256 |
4a76221c766bf5b0e17516a71bbcb315399fa3fcc75f298e492ace8928dc2158
|
File details
Details for the file mecheyeapi-2.5.4-cp37-cp37m-manylinux_2_27_x86_64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p37-cp37m-manylinux_2_27_x86_64.whl
- Upload date:
- Size: 22.7 MB
- Tags: CPython 3.7m, manylinux: glibc 2.27+ x86-64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
80b46d8b7633807c4e1e955afbdbbed217994f375fd9ebb3f2b367f23e1bc90a
|
|
| MD5 |
ae8a14f5f1056180434c4712865f65b7
|
|
| BLAKE2b-256 |
b3bc182e45c7b0c3a07503879b2a072b47602ee92a10ca9be82e73f0a71ff1c9
|
File details
Details for the file mecheyeapi-2.5.4-cp37-cp37m-manylinux_2_27_aarch64.whl.
File metadata
- Download URL: mecheyeapi-2.5.4-cp37-cp37m-manylinux_2_27_aarch64.whl
- Upload date:
- Size: 10.6 MB
- Tags: CPython 3.7m, manylinux: glibc 2.27+ ARM64
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/6.2.0 CPython/3.11.9
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
84dbba2fbcc1009e79a454e0ee874d18521caef8189cb286e1395b52826d17da
|
|
| MD5 |
28b69518a1d5a493710f1304e5ae83a4
|
|
| BLAKE2b-256 |
592d36a424b18a4e63cf7f8df5d1def46d26ff9df6de5a73a14689ce8db7fb79
|